    Twitter is full of promoters. There're more people trying to promote their business than the ones actually interested in their businesses. So if you have 10,000 followers, more than 5,000 of those will be just other people/companies trying to sell you something. Also, it does not bring much traffic at all. With 2,000 followers I barely get 5 visitors when I post a link to the article I wrote. I'm guessing out of those 2,000 people that follow me, 1,500 are just there to promote themselves.

    This is where the flaw in Twitter promotion lies. I'm guessing (so correct me if I'm wrong), you used some type of Twitter exchange/automated follower program.

    A more naturally grown follower list will result in a better response to your campaigns.

    I currently sit at around 75-80 followers with 10-20 visiting my links when I post them on twitter. Those 10 to 20 visits, result in many more due to users retweeting.

    There are times when I get a significant amount of click throughs, and times that I don't...depending on which profile and what I have Tweeted, but overall...I don't think Twitter is a very effective marketing platform for small business..or at least it doesn't beat Facebook.

    It's true, it seems these days that there are more marketers and spammers on Twitter than "real people". everyone has a pitch, product, or affiliate link. If they ban affiliate links, it would help out tremendously, and you would at least have links from actual business and site owners, not just anyone who signs up to a program that tells them to spam Twitter with them....That is what makes Twitter a true spam fest...everyone and their mother is posting affiliate links to "dating" site sign ups, "make money online" scams, and "how to get more Twitter followers" gimmicks.. and it's rampant.
